The Nucla Station ceased operation in 2019, and was demolished in 2022. <br /> Reclamation Plan <br /> Reclamation activities occurred concurrently with mining. The backfill and grading timeline is <br /> outlined in Table 2.05.4(2)(a)-1 of the permit. A typical diagram illustrating the mining and <br /> backfill process is provided in Map 2.05.3-1 of the permit. Following backfilling and grading, <br /> topsoil is redistributed to the thicknesses shown on Map 2.05.4(2)(d)-1. The type and thickness <br /> of topsoil is related to the post-mining land use. Replaced soils are prepared for seeding as <br /> described in Sections 2.05.4(2)(d) and (e) of the permit. The reclaimed lands will be capable of <br /> supporting the same uses that were present prior to disturbance. <br /> Water rights and usage <br /> ERMR owns several water rights which are detailed in Table 1 of Appendix 2.05.6(3)-lb of the <br /> permit.
